This weekend, get ready for Halloween with a thrilling scary movie marathon.  Head to Netflix and rent movies that you’ve always been scared of or maybe that you love, and make a night of it with your significant other.   Pop some popcorn and get ready for a few thrills and chills that’ll have you jumping into the arms of the person you love – the perfect way to get close to your honey.

If neither of you are frightened by horror movies, then make it a competition to see how many you can watch in one night without falling asleep on the couch.  This challenge is sure to keep your eyes wide open until the break of dawn.  Check out this ‘top’ scary movie list on Google.

If you and your partner are huge horror movie fans, consider playing scary movie trivia and see just how much you really know about the genre.  This is a great way to bond with your sweetheart and share your common interests – plus a little competition never hurt anyone.  Start your marathon on a weekend because rest assured, you may have nightmares when it’s over.  This could lead to the two of you waking up holding one another in the middle of the night, which is as far from scary as you can get!
